我正在尝试配置一个Jenkins服务器,该服务器将分离Jobs以运行我们项目的构建并测试它们。
问题在于,当我们运行测试作业时,他们不会自动轮询构建中的更改。 这些数据可以很容易地在我们的构建作业中找到,但是测试作业没有polling.log(没有源代码,因此没有更改,这些作业是mstest作业并且没有构建任何东西)。
我们希望能够向我们的开发人员展示项目源代码中的更改(在最后两个版本之间),以便他们知道谁可以负责打破测试。
我不确定自己是否清楚明白,如果您需要更多信息来回答我的问题,请随时问我。
答案 0 :(得分:0)
这对手动启动的构建不起作用,但如果从成功的构建作业中触发测试作业,则测试作业实例将显示触发它的构建作业。这提供了良好的可追溯性。
还要考虑Blame Upstream Committers或Claim插件,它们可能会让您分道扬..